Вопрос или проблема
Я ищу способ создать резервную и аварийную микросд-карту для Microsoft Surface Pro 2, который имеет встроенный слот для микросд. Вероятно, я не смогу выбрать только одно решение для использования в качестве аварийного диска и захочу создать мультибот-диск.
Мне нужно использовать флеш-карту в качестве многозагрузочного диска, на который я также смогу сохранять образы дисков и другие данные. По крайней мере, мне нужно будет создать резервную копию установки Windows 8.1.
Существует множество вопросов и руководств по созданию (мульти-) загрузочных CD/DVD. Что мне нужно знать о флеш-картах в частности, по сравнению с CD/DVD? В частности, какую файловую систему и загрузчик мне нужно использовать; есть ли что-то еще специфическое для флеш-карт?
Я предпочитаю решение с открытым исходным кодом, совместимое с разными платформами.
Я думаю, что настоящая проблема в том, что планшеты Surface используют UEFI, поэтому процесс загрузки других ОС на них более сложен. Нет никаких реальных различий между использованием UFD и SD-карт в качестве загрузочных устройств. Просто отформатируйте SD-карту в FAT32 и следуйте инструкциям по созданию мультибот-диска UFD. Однако настоящим ограничением является UEFI и создание диска, который будет с ним работать.
Вашим лучшим вариантом для использования Linux было бы установить Ubuntu (или какую-либо другую ОС на основе *nix) на саму SD-карту, используя универсальный установщик драйверов (содержит драйверы для всего известного оборудования). Это будет портативно в каком-то смысле, но вы можете столкнуться с некоторыми проблемами, так как это не живая установка.
Единственный другой вариант – использовать rEFInd
(скачайте его и извлеките файлы на SD-карту. Затем поместите Live ISO (или несколько Live ISO) на SD-карту. Она должна(tm) иметь возможность загружать их.
Ответ или решение
Создание мультизагрузочной (multi-bootable) micro-SD карты для устройства Microsoft Surface Pro 2 может быть достаточно сложным процессом, особенно с учетом особенностей работы с UEFI. В данном ответе я изложу все необходимые шаги и рекомендации, которые помогут вам успешно создать мультизагрузочную SD карту, а также дам советы по файловым системам и загрузчикам.
1. Подготовка micro-SD карты
Для начала необходимо подготовить micro-SD карту. Следует обратить внимание на следующие моменты:
- Емкость карты: Рекомендуется использовать карту не менее 16 ГБ, так как вам, вероятно, понадобится сохранить на ней несколько образов операционных систем и данных.
- Форматирование: Форматируйте SD карту в файловую систему FAT32. Данный формат поддерживается UEFI и позволяет загружать различные операционные системы.
Для форматирования вы можете воспользоваться стандартной утилитой дисков Windows или командой diskpart
в командной строке:
diskpart
list disk
select disk X # X - номер вашей SD карты
clean
create partition primary
format fs=fat32 quick
assign
exit
2. Выбор загрузчика
Для создания мультизагрузочной SD карты потребуется загрузчик. Я рекомендую использовать rEFInd, который хорошо совместим с UEFI.
- rEFInd: Это open-source загрузчик, который позволяет управлять загрузкой нескольких операционных систем. Для его установки выполните следующие шаги:
- Скачайте rEFInd с официального сайта.
- Распакуйте архив и скопируйте содержимое в корень вашей micro-SD карты.
- Скрипт установки rEFInd может потребовать настройки, чтобы обеспечить правильную загрузку. Убедитесь, что файл
refind.conf
конфигурирован в соответствии с вашими потребностями.
3. Добавление образов операционных систем
Для того чтобы добавить образы операционных систем (например, различных дистрибутивов Linux или образ Windows 8.1), выполните следующие шаги:
- Извлеките ISO-образы, которые вы хотите использовать, и скопируйте их на SD карту.
- В файле
refind.conf
вам необходимо добавить соответствующие записи для загрузки этих образов. Пример записи может выглядеть следующим образом:
menuentry "Ubuntu Live" {
loader /path/to/ubuntu.iso
}
4. Плюсы и минусы мультизагрузочных SD карт
Существует ряд преимуществ использования мультизагрузочной SD карты:
- Мобильность: Вы сможете использовать разные операционные системы и утилиты без необходимости подключения дополнительных устройств.
- Гибкость: Карта может содержать резервные копии, данные и образы систем, что удобно для восстановления.
Однако, стоит учитывать и недостатки:
- Совместимость: Не все системы могут корректно загружаться с SD карт, особенно если они требуют эфирного доступа.
- Скорость: Сравнительно с SSD, скорости чтения/записи на SD картах могут быть ниже.
Заключение
Создание мультизагрузочной micro-SD карты для Microsoft Surface Pro 2 требует понимания особенностей UEFI и работы с загрузчиками. Следуя описанным шагам, вы сможете создать мощный инструмент для активации различных операционных систем и выполнения резервных копий. Рекомендуется периодически проверять актуальность используемых образов и обновлять конфигурацию карты для обеспечения максимальной функциональности.